# Break-Glass: Catalog Cache Invalidation

Scope: the Pinrow product catalog at Veldstone Retail. If stale prices persist after a purge and the Hollowmere invalidation queue is wedged, use break-glass to flush the edge tier directly. Contractors: get verbal sign-off from the catalog lead first. Steps: open the Hollowmere admin shell, select emergency-flush, confirm the tenant, and run it once — repeated flushes thrash the origin. Access is logged and expires after 20 minutes. Unseal the admin shell with the passphrase below.

recovery phrase for kahop-tajog: istix-casvan

## Changelog — Gaugewick Sidecar v2.8.0

Changed defaults: the metrics-aggregation sidecar now flushes buffers every 15 seconds instead of 60, and scrape endpoints bind to the loopback interface unless explicitly overridden. TLS verification for upstream pushes is now enabled by default. Security reviewers should note that the previous permissive bind behavior is fully removed, not merely deprecated. For audit purposes, the complete set of defaults shipped with this release is reproduced below.

settings of tagef-bawif:
DRUIX_HOST=druix.zemvarlabs.internal
DRUIX_PORT=8000

Subject: Handover — monthly partitioning

For the sync: the Ridgefell events table is now partitioned by month. New partitions auto-create on the 25th; old ones detach after 13 months. Watch the creation job — it failed silently once. Verify partition state on the primary by connecting with the string below.

primary connection of yagep-kahip = redis://giliel_svc:zYiKsLL2PLpfPL@db-348f.xolmarsys.corp:5432/fenwyn

**Changelog — FxRounder 1.9** Renamed `CONVERT_PRECISION_TOKEN` to `FXROUNDER_SIGNING_SECRET` for clarity after the half-cent drift fix in the Ostvale conversion path. Reviewers: the old key is no longer read at all, so stale env files will fail loudly at startup. Update your local env file to include the following line:

env line for fafof-fahag: LEDGER_TOKEN5=f8790